-- | Append any new price directives (with different from commodity,
-- to commodity, or date) from the second list to the first.
-- (Does not remove redundant prices from the first; just avoids adding more.)
mergePriceDirectives :: [PriceDirective] -> [PriceDirective] -> [PriceDirective]
mergePriceDirectives pds1 pds2 =
pds1 ++ [ pd | pd <- pds2 , pdid pd `notElem` pds1ids ]
where
pds1ids = map pdid pds1
pdid PriceDirective{pddate,pdcommodity,pdamount} = (pddate, pdcommodity, acommodity pdamount)
showPriceDirective :: PriceDirective -> T.Text
showPriceDirective mp = T.unwords [
"P",
T.pack . show $ pddate mp,
quoteCommoditySymbolIfNeeded $ pdcommodity mp,
wbToText . showAmountB defaultFmt{displayZeroCommodity=True} $ pdamount mp
]
-- | Convert a market price directive to a corresponding one in the
-- opposite direction, if possible. (A price directive with a zero
-- price can't be reversed.)
--
-- The price's display precision will be set to show all significant
-- decimal digits (or if they appear infinite, a smaller default precision (8).
-- This is visible eg in the prices command's output.
--
reversePriceDirective :: PriceDirective -> Maybe PriceDirective
reversePriceDirective pd@PriceDirective{pdcommodity=c, pdamount=a}
| amountIsZero a = Nothing
| otherwise = Just pd{pdcommodity=acommodity a, pdamount=a'}
where
lbl = lbl_ "reversePriceDirective"
a' =
amountSetFullPrecisionUpTo (Just defaultMaxPrecision) $
invertAmount a{acommodity=c}
& dbg9With (lbl "calculated reverse price".showAmount)
-- & dbg9With (lbl "precision of reverse price".show.amountDisplayPrecision)
